John Keiller Greig
John Keiller Greig (born June 12, 1881 in Dundee , Scotland , † 1971 in Ballater , Scotland) was a British figure skater who started in a single run .
He became the British figure skating champion in 1907, 1909 and 1910. At the Olympic Games in London in 1908 , the first in which figure skating was in the program, he finished fourth behind three Swedes. His only participation in the European Championships , he finished in fourth place in 1910 .
After his active career, he acted as a judge at the World Figure Skating Championships in 1912 and 1914
